Dr. Gretchen Hawley discusses the significance of new symptoms in MS rehabilitation and offers practical strategies for improvement.

In this episode of The MSing Link Podcast, I share a personal story about falling down the stairs while seven months pregnant, and how my experience relates closely to what so many living with multiple sclerosis (MS) go through when working to get stronger and walk better.  We explore the gate control theory of pain and discuss why new symptoms can pop up during MS exercise routines—and how this often signals progress, not setbacks.  If you’ve ever felt discouraged by changing MS symptoms, tune in for expert insights, practical strategies, and encouragement tailored for your journey.
